Making audio CD’s with CDRW media.

“Can I write to CD ReWritable media using my CD-RW drive in Jam?”

Assuming you have a current version that supports your drive the answer is yes. However we don’t recommend it. Although creating audio CDs using CD-RW media is possible, it isn’t very useful in most situations. The reason is because CD-RW media can generally only be read by CD ROM drives equipped with special “multi-read” lasers or DVD players. Most consumer audio CD players (home stereo, car stereo, and portables) are not equipped with these “multi-read” lasers and cannot “see” CD-RW discs. Recently some CD players (particularly car audio players) have started using multi-read lasers so if your intentions are to play the discs on one of these you should be fine.
